OASIS Group starts on second phase of PRIMA Shopping Center (RO)

Oasis Retail Development & Consulting has announced the start of the second development phase of the PRIMA Shopping Center project in Sibiu, a total investment of €30m. "At the end of 2023, the total area for shopping and leisure will be 80,000m², with an estimated average traffic of 45,000 visitors per day, in one of the largest retail parks in the center-west part of the country", explained Klaus Reisenauer, Partner within the Oasis group, adding: "Retail parks are the big winners of the pandemic and maintain their tendency to be a safe and preferred shopping destination for Romanians. Due to the very airy concept, with access to all stores directly from the parking lot, minimal and streamlined service charge costs and significantly reduced rents, compared to a closed mall, retail parks represent one of the most competitive retail real estate products."

 

PRIMA Shopping Center is located on an 18-hectares plot in the northern part of Sibiu, next to the Hornbach DIY store and Kaufland, the latter being opened in 2021. The shopping center has a privileged position in Sibiu, just 10 minutes from the Historical Center, in an area that is in full development, and is located right at the exit to Medias and to the A1 Bucharest - Arad highway, which connects to Sebe? and to route E81 in the direction of Ramnicu Valcea - Bucharest. The first phase was inaugurated in Q4 2021 and includes 11 stores comprising to 9,000m² including C&A, Takko FashionDeichmannFlancoPepcoJyskKIK, Agroland Mega, SuperZoo, Numero Uno and Sportisimo.

 

In the next phase of development, until the end of 2023, several large retail stores will be built, acting as other main anchors in the project: a JUMBO store, two furniture stores (MomaX and XXXLutz), a hyperpharmacy (Dr. Max), a children's playground and a supermarket (Lidl). More fashion, footwear, cosmetics, perfumery, jewelry, watches, home accessories and home & deco stores, will complete the existing mix. There will be no shortage of essential services, beauty, telecom, banking, and in the food segment, the retail park will have several shops with traditional products and specialties, -coffee shops and restaurants, with generous terraces. At the entrance to the complex, on an area of over 900m², a Romanian quick-service restaurant from the Super Mama chain and a KFC Drive Thru fast food will be inaugurated.

 

"All the spaces with surfaces over 400m² from the second phase of PRIMA Shopping Center project are pre-leased. We will bring important brands to Sibiu, and some of them even for the first time for this region. In the next period, we intend to complete the leasing process for locations with smaller surfaces, between 50-150m², which will complete the existing tenan mix", said Oana Agachi, Head of Leasing within the Oasis Group.

 

"Regarding the efficiency of the annual energy consumption for all tenants within the retail park, we intend to implement intelligent solutions for production, monitoring and optimization, in order to maintain the energy performance of the buildings at an optimal level. With the help of green energy, we will significantly reduce energy costs, in parallel with the reduction of greenhouse gas emissions," commented Kurt Wagner, Partner of Oasis group
